What Is Your Shadow Self?
The shadow self is a concept developed by psychologist Carl Jung, referring to the unconscious parts of ourselves that we suppress. These include traits, emotions, and memories that society, family, or personal beliefs have deemed unacceptable.
Your shadow might include:
- Wounded inner child experiences (abandonment, neglect, rejection)
- Repressed emotions like anger, jealousy, or sadness
- Unfulfilled desires that don’t align with who you “should” be
- Trauma responses such as people-pleasing or self-sabotage
Recognizing your shadow self isn’t about shame—it’s about healing. When you bring awareness to these parts, you move toward self-acceptance and spiritual transformation.
Signs That Your Shadow Self Is Affecting You
Before diving into shadow work, it’s essential to recognize how self-sabotage manifests in your life. While we often think of self-sabotage as a deliberate act, it’s frequently unconscious. We may sabotage ourselves in a number of subtle ways, including:
- Strong Emotional Triggers – Certain people or situations evoke extreme emotional responses. If someone’s confidence irritates you, it may reflect insecurities within you.
- Patterns of Self-Sabotage – You struggle to maintain healthy relationships, procrastinate on important goals, or repeatedly make choices that hurt you.
- Projection Onto Others – You dislike traits in others that actually exist within you, but you haven’t acknowledged them.
- Unexplained Fear or Anxiety – You avoid deep emotional connections, struggle with trust, or feel disconnected from your true self.
- The “Perfect Persona” – You try to be overly positive or spiritual to avoid facing difficult emotions, creating an inauthentic self-image.
If any of these sound familiar, it’s time to face your shadow self and begin your healing journey.

1. Use Journaling Prompts for Shadow Work
Journaling is one of the most powerful tools for uncovering your shadow self. It allows you to express emotions, recognize patterns, and track your healing progress.
Try These Prompts:
- What emotions do I struggle to express, and why?
- Who triggers me the most, and what do they reflect in me?
- What childhood wounds still affect my adult relationships?
- What fears hold me back from living authentically?
- What do I judge in others that might exist within me?
